Ethicon, Inc. based in Somerville, New Jersey, was founded more than 80 years ago, as a pioneer in suture development and manufacturing, helping to transform the safety and effectiveness of open surgery. Ethicon Endo-Surgery, Inc. was created 25 years ago, in Cincinnati, Ohio, developing creative devices that have driven the groundbreaking shift from open to minimally invasive surgery that continues to lead the industry today.
